2525201649 has 10 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 3772214930. Its totient is φ = 1683467712.
The previous prime is 2525201647. The next prime is 2525201677. The reversal of 2525201649 is 9461025252.
2525201649 is a `hidden beast` number, since 2 + 5 + 2 + 5 + 2 + 0 + 1 + 649 = 666.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 1602561024 + 922640625 = 40032^2 + 30375^2 .
It is not a de Polignac number, because 2525201649 - 21 = 2525201647 is a prime.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×25252016492 = 12753286736224638402, which contains 22 as substring.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(2525201647)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 9 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 15587584 + ... + 15587745.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(377221493).
Almost surely, 22525201649 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
2525201649 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1247013281).
2525201649 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
2525201649 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 31175341 (or 31175332 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 43200, while the sum is 36.
The square root of 2525201649 is about 50251.3845480898. The cubic root of 2525201649 is about 1361.7540891978.
